With the approval of the Central Organization Committee, the National Development and Reform Commission established the National Energy Conservation Center. The National Energy Conservation Center is a public institution directly under the National Development and Reform Commission and a technical support institution for the government to implement energy conservation management.

The main responsibilities are: to undertake research tasks such as energy-saving policies, regulations, planning and management systems; Entrusted by the relevant government departments, undertake energy-saving evaluation and demonstration of fixed assets investment projects and put forward evaluation opinions; Organize and popularize energy-saving technologies, products and new mechanisms; Carry out energy-saving publicity, training, information dissemination and consulting services; Entrusted by relevant government departments, undertake the management of energy efficiency labeling.

Carry out international exchanges and cooperation in the field of energy conservation. At present, the National Development and Reform Commission has started the preparation of the National Energy Conservation Center.

Public security organs are an important part of the people's government and state administrative organs, and are also responsible for the investigation of criminal cases. Public security organs are the functional departments of the government, which manage social order according to law and exercise state administrative power. At the same time, public security organs investigate criminal cases according to law and exercise state judicial power.

The nature of public security organs is twofold, that is, both administrative and judicial. To prevent, stop and investigate illegal and criminal activities; Preventing and combating terrorist activities; Maintain public order and stop acts that endanger public order; Manage traffic, fire fighting and dangerous goods; Manage household registration, resident identity cards, nationality, immigration affairs and foreigners' residence and travel in China.
